Description & Requirements For our E quity Sales Trading Europe division in London we are looking to hire a:
Event-driven Analyst / Salesperson
Your role in the team
Berenberg’s market leading European event-driven team are seeking an experienced analyst / salesperson to join the team. The successful applicant will be instrumental in generating event-driven content for the team’s hedge fund clients, liaising with internal sales and execution desks and ensuring the team’s views are disseminated across the market. Berenberg’s event-driven team are looking for applicants with a strong understanding of event-driven investing strategies and excellent ability to communicate in both written and verbal formats.
What will you do?

  • Research European deal situations across varied sectors and market caps
  • Communicate the team’s insights internally to sales and execution teams and externally to event-driven hedge fund clients
  • Liaise with Berenberg’s nearly 100 strong fundamental research department to provide clients with single stock and sector expertise
  • Help organise corporate access opportunities so that clients can meet companies with an event-driven angle to their investment case
  • Undertake daily tasks such as maintaining the team’s deal spreadsheets and contribute to the daily morning email

Who are we looking for?
  • Previous experience (either sell- or buy-side) analysing event-driven situations is required
  • The ability to analyse complex deal structures quickly and communicate succinctly
  • Advanced IT skills, including all standard Office applications
